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5640309782 78 7117204 53161999200 28
523085 77 00014
523085 77 00014
39439095 92 65
All about undefined
Interested in learning more?
523085 77 00014
39439095 92 65
See more
27814496 771312 5808
46 251685 2401 15942694317 24793
See more
85190710 4171918
349345 87396 9048 80321817 12447
See more